If it were me, and I weren't attacking it as a project as I've done with the current one, I'd put crash bungs on it before I even rode it. Probably a Remus Revolution end can. Bodywork... F Fabbri screen, seat cowl. Maybe a tail tidy, but maybe not, there's a lot to be said for a mudguard that works. Ditch the pillion pegs. Chewy's bolt kit, maybe. And that'd be that. Well, I'd change the pads, but I'd not recommend that for you at this point.

Cheapest mod, Don't buy an SV. Buy the bike you want in the first place.

Sound daft, I don't think so. The SV is such a money pit with all the after market stuff you need to buy to make it look right, make it go right, make it sound right, make it handle right, make it stop right.

And then when you have done all that you will find that has no impact on valuation, desirability and everything is still a compromise.

Still it is some of the rawness of the SV that makes it fun. But at the end of the day a cheap bike does not necessarily mean cheap ownership.
